What is the xb7 xfinity modem and who is it for?

The xb7 xfinity modem is a DOCSIS 3.1 gateway designed for Comcast's Xfinity service, combining a cable modem with a built‑in router. For homeowners and renters who want a single device to handle internet access in living rooms, home offices, and bedrooms, the XB7 offers convenient plug‑and‑play activation. According to Modem Answers, this model is widely adopted by households that value simple setup and reliable performance without juggling separate modem and router hardware. It supports modern features like multi‑gigabit capable connectivity and a straightforward activation flow with Xfinity. If your internet plan includes gigabit service or higher, the xb7 xfinity modem can typically handle the traffic while keeping your network simple and centralized. However, users should be aware that some advanced networking features or third‑party firmware options may be limited on devices tethered to the Xfinity ecosystem. In short, the xb7 is best for households seeking dependable performance with minimal configuration, especially if you already subscribe to Xfinity services.

Key specs and what they mean

The xb7 xfinity modem combines the cable modem with a built‑in router, eliminating the need for a separate gateway in many setups. Core specifications include DOCSIS 3.1 support, which enables higher theoretical throughput and better spectrum efficiency, especially on upgraded service tiers. Built‑in routing provides NAT, firewall features, and basic parental controls, making it a convenient all‑in‑one solution for small to medium homes. For home offices or dense apartment layouts, the device typically handles multiple connected devices and common smart home gear without noticeable slowdowns during peak usage. Practically speaking, buyers should review their ISP plan and consider whether the xb7’s wireless capability and wired ports meet demand for streaming, gaming, and video conferencing. Modem Answers notes that most households benefit from simplified management and fewer devices, but note that power users or homes with custom networking needs might prefer a separate high‑end router.

Setup and activation: step‑by‑step

Activation is designed to be straightforward. Steps generally include verifying your Xfinity plan supports the xb7, connecting the device to the coaxial line, powering it up, and following on‑screen prompts in the Xfinity app or web portal. The process often involves accepting terms, registering the device, and running a quick gateway check for connectivity. After activation, you can configure Wi‑Fi SSIDs, set a strong admin password, and enable firewall protections. If you’re transferring from an old modem, unplugging the old gear and pairing the xb7 with your current network topology is usually completed within minutes. For users who value speed and reliability, keeping firmware up to date is recommended, since updates can include security patches and performance improvements. In short, the xb7 setup is designed to be accessible to homeowners and renters who want a fast start without complex configuration.

Common issues and practical troubleshooting steps

Encountering activation failures or intermittent connectivity is not unusual for first‑time users. Start with a simple power cycle (unplug, wait 30 seconds, plug back in) and re‑run the activation flow. Check coax connections for tightness and inspect the wall outlet for signal integrity; a poor signal can create slowdowns or drops. If Wi‑Fi performance is uneven, re‑position the router or consider adjusting channel selections and interference sources, such as neighboring networks or dense walls. Firmware updates typically occur automatically but can be forced via the admin interface. If activation remains blocked, contact your service provider to confirm service provisioning on your account and the device’s MAC address is correctly registered. Modem Answers emphasizes a patient, methodical approach to troubleshooting, which often resolves most common issues without additional gear.

Security and privacy best practices

Security starts with basics: change the default admin password, enable the firewall, and ensure the device firmware is current. Disable WPS if it’s enabled, enable network isolation for guest devices, and use strong unique Wi‑Fi passwords. Regularly review connected devices to spot unfamiliar entries and consider enabling automatic security updates where possible. If you plan to use a separate router, ensure the xb7 is in bridge mode only if you understand the implications for NAT and firewall behavior. In practice, consistent firmware updates and prudent network hygiene are the cheapest and most effective defenses for home networks.

Buying, renting, and cost considerations

A central decision is whether to rent the xb7 from the provider or buy your own equivalent gateway. Renting offers convenience and certain support benefits, but it can add up over years. Buying a gateway with DOCSIS 3.1 support is often a smarter long‑term investment for households that intend to stay with Xfinity and desire direct control over the device. It’s important to verify compatibility with your service tier and confirm activation steps with Xfinity. If your plan evolves or you move to a different provider, check unlock policies and return options for the device. The Modem Answers team recommends evaluating total cost of ownership, warranty coverage, and potential upgrade paths when deciding between renting and buying.
